Simple Strategies Often Perform Better in FX Trading Online

There is a common belief that the more complex a trading strategy is, the better the results will be. Many new traders fall into this trap. They build layered systems with multiple indicators, signals, and filters, believing complexity will provide safety or certainty. But in most cases, the opposite is true. In the world of FX trading online, simplicity often leads to better clarity, faster decision-making, and more consistent outcomes.

Too Many Tools Can Create Confusion

It starts innocently enough. A trader adds one indicator to confirm entries, then another to manage exits, and another to filter for volatility. Before long, the chart is filled with so many tools that the original price movement becomes hard to see. This leads to analysis paralysis, where the trader is unsure which signal to trust.

Simple strategies strip away this confusion. They focus on key price zones, a small number of technical tools, and clearly defined rules. In FX trading online, being able to make clean, confident decisions often produces stronger results than second-guessing every move.

Simplicity Strengthens Discipline

When your strategy is simple, it becomes easier to follow. There are fewer variables to consider and fewer reasons to break your rules. You either see your setup or you do not. There is no room for debate or overthinking.

This structure builds discipline. Over time, you begin to trust the process. You follow it consistently. And as results improve, that trust deepens. Traders in FX trading online who follow simple systems often spend less time doubting themselves and more time executing with focus.

Cleaner Strategies Are Easier to Improve

Complex strategies are harder to analyze and improve. When something goes wrong, it is not clear which element caused the problem. Was it the indicator setting? The time frame? The filter? Too many moving parts make it difficult to isolate the issue.

On the other hand, when a strategy is simple, it is easier to spot weaknesses and make adjustments. You can test new entry points, try different position sizing, or adjust your risk parameters with clarity. In FX trading online, this kind of precision helps traders grow without overhauling their entire approach.

Simple Does Not Mean Shallow

Simplicity does not mean a lack of skill or intelligence. It means cutting away what is unnecessary so that what remains is powerful. Many of the world’s most successful traders use simple systems based on support and resistance, trendlines, or basic candlestick patterns. They understand that trading is not about showing off technical knowledge, it is about making smart, consistent decisions.

In FX trading online, elegant systems built around straightforward principles are often the ones that stand the test of time. They can adapt to changing conditions without becoming confusing or overwhelming.

Confidence Comes from Clarity

When your charts are clean and your rules are easy to remember, you feel in control. You are no longer swayed by every flicker of the market or tempted to chase every move. You begin to see trading for what it really is, a game of probabilities, not perfection.

In the end, complexity adds layers. Simplicity brings clarity. And in FX trading online, clarity leads to action. It helps you execute without hesitation, manage risk more effectively, and focus on what matters most like making consistent, smart decisions that move you closer to your trading goals.
